Key Differences

In short — Ryzen 7 PRO 3700U outperforms Celeron G3900 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Ryzen 7 PRO 3700U is 1315 days newer than Celeron G3900.

Advantages of AMD Ryzen 7 PRO 3700U

  • Performs up to 4% better in Shadow of the Tomb Raider: Definitive Edition than Celeron G3900 - 187 vs 179 FPS
  • Consumes up to 71% less energy than Intel Celeron G3900 - 15 vs 51 Watts
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Celeron G3900 - 8 vs 2 threads
